Output 70559e61007dbd70425f0849163dff3e9e80bded001684fd749500041d64d48a:4

value
19329617
script pubkey
OP_0 OP_PUSHBYTES_32 a695a6039719cf4614b11f1a5a35309460427fdaa3847b4298077fbc90efaae2
address
bc1q5626vquhr885v993rud95dfsj3syyl765wz8ks5cqalmey804t3qzxz7kd
transaction
70559e61007dbd70425f0849163dff3e9e80bded001684fd749500041d64d48a
spent
true